UK rules out returning troops to Taliban-controlled Afghanistan
Al Jazeera
UK defence secretary says the Taliban’s rapid takeover is a sign of the international community’s ‘failure’.
British and NATO forces will not return to Afghanistan to fight the Taliban, the United Kingdom’s defence secretary said, after the group took control of Kabul following a blistering nationwide offensive. Ben Wallace told Sky News on Monday that it was “not on the cards that we’re going to go back” as reports of bloodshed in the Afghan capital fuelled concerns of a looming humanitarian crisis. “I acknowledge that the Taliban are in control of the country,” Wallace said.More Related News
